Morning Read: Dempsey and David Watch Hoops

Tottenham's Clint Dempsey finds Chelsea's David Luiz at a New York Knicks game in London and the pair ham it up for the camera; a teeny, tiny bit of Landon Donovan news; Juan Agudelo as "omelet man."

  • Clint Dempsey, who is still not wanted by Liverpool, went to the Knicks-Pistons game in London... and hung out with David Luiz. Because, why not?

  • The saga of Jurgen Klinsmann trying to get Landon Donovan to go out with him continues, to no avail. “We texted back and forth since the MLS Cup final,” Klinsmann says. “I've offered lunches, dinners, coffee. But he wanted to take his break, and I said that's fine.” Maybe he’s just not that into you, coach. Donovan will meet with club manager Bruce Arena this weekend, which will hopefully give us all a better idea about something, or at least another useless quote to write about.

  • ASN's Noah Davis looks for solutions to the USMNT’s “centerback conundrum” and talks with Tim Howard and Alexi Lalas about the importance of communication in the back. Says Howard: “It can be as obvious as 'the sun is shining,' but it needs to be a constant flow of communication that keeps everybody on their toes."

  • Clarence Goodson’s is mulling a move to Orduspor in Turkey. The 30-year-old is currently at the club checking the place out, and his current club Brondby says (in awesomely-broken Google Translate language): “Both we and Clarence is in dialogue with Orduspor on a switch, but there is not an agreement in place.”

  • Brad Davis doesn’t want to waste what may be his last chance with the U.S. Klinsmann says Davis and other veterans in camp “know time isn’t on their side” and their presence in camp “inspires the younger ones.”

  • Since this is “Morning Read,” you definitely need to know what some of the January camp lads eat for breakfast. Juan Agudelo fancies himself an omelet, but admits he’s no good at making them. Says Josh Gatt: “I don't really like eating in the morning, but I know it's important.” Darn right it is.
